RMIT Vietnam’s new Personal Edge app digitalises the employability skills learning experience, preparing students for life and work.

As students develop their employability skills in the Personal Edge program, they can now manage their progression on their mobile device with the new Personal Edge web app. 

“The new Personal Edge app speaks to the University’s efforts to continuously enhance student experience and implement digitalisation in learning and teaching,” said Manuela Spiga, Senior Manager of Careers and Industry Relations.

“With this new platform, students can build up an inventory of skills which can be used to impress employers upon graduation.”

The app allows students who enrol in the Personal Edge program to create a digital portfolio where they can showcase six skill sets: creative thinker, confident communicator, cross-cultural team player, ethical leader, digital citizen, and career strategist.

Students can demonstrate how they develop or perform the skills in a learning or working experience via the framework STARTLP – situation, task, action, result, learn/plan.

With this digital portfolio, they can also attach evidence of their learning experiences like certificate scans, photos of real works, recommendations from teammates and supervisors, and others.

Besides having an online record of their experience, students can take advantage of other useful functions directly on the app. They can book workshops and events offered by the Careers and Industry Relations office, compete with each other on the Monthly Leaderboard, and redeem points for gifts.

The app is available from Semester 3, 2017 for students who enrol in the Personal Edge program.
